Parcels Announce New Single and Leeds Date

PARCELS have shared another glimpse of what’s to come on their hotly anticipated debut album today, in the form of new track BEMYSELF. The track has been released on Kitsuné / Because Music and the full album is expected later this year.

BEMYSELF is the latest offering in an irresistible series of tracks to come from the Berlin-based Australian five piece band. Picking up perfectly where last single TIEDUPRIGHTNOW left us earlier this summer, BEMYSELF is an intriguingly sultry take on their signature modern disco, a slow-burning gem that feels destined to soundtrack the lazy days spent in the sun.

Already having surpassed 50 million streams, sold out sizeable shows worldwide (including a date at London’s Koko, on top of touring with Phoenix), made their US TV debut on Conan and of course famously written tracks with legendry duo Daft Punk, Parcels are a band ascending. Currently putting the finishing touches on their debut album (which is expected to be released later this year), they’ve emerged already as one of the most vibrant and vital new bands around with a truly global and musically-diverse audience.

Louie Swain (synth), Patrick Hetherington (synth), Noah Hill (bass), Anatole Serret (drums) and Jules Crommelin (guitar) are all schoolmates from Byron Bay. 3 years ago, they made the big leap of moving to Berlin, finding in one Europe’s most creative cities the prospects that equalled their ambition. Parcels’ early sound suitably reflects this ability to travel, and transform yourself: following an eclectic thread from The Beach Boys and Chic through to yacht rock heroes like Steely Dan, all the while blending elements of electronica, funk and tirelessly-drilled live musicianship into classic but contemporary pop. It’s in their Berlin exile – and its long history of creative breakthroughs – that the alchemy which makes Parcels so refreshing first crystallised. Theirs is a maniacal taste for perfection when it comes to production, composition and arrangement, with a live show so accomplished that Daft Punk offered to work with them on the spot (the first time the duo have chosen an emerging act to add to their list of collaborators, which also includes the likes of Kanye, The Weeknd and Pharrell).

BEMYSELF is another tantalising glimpse of good times ahead. On that, and so much more, Parcels look set to keep delivering the goods.

Parcels will be playing at Leeds Stylus on November 7th this year.
